It is reported that while the revolutionary forces arrested non-CDM staff from revenue and immigration departments at around 4:00 p.m. on May 21, a clash broke out with the military, killing 5 people including the deputy staff officer of revenue, immigration staff, and PDF members.

The clash with the military broke out on the way back after the Taw Twin Tutpi (LPDF) force arrested non-CDM staff of the revenue department and immigration department, and a total of 5 people, 3 men and 2 women, including non-CDM deputy staff officer of the revenue department, immigration staff, and PDF members, due to the firing by the military.

In a press release from the military council, 7 men came to attack the immigration office and the township revenue office in Parami Ward of Sagaing. After clearing them upon receiving the information, the bodies of 3 men and 2 women aged around 35 years, one MA-13 ​​(R-48567), one pistol and ammunition, a car, and a motorcycle were reportedly seized.

BRAVEHEART ARMY-BHA reported that on May 21, 3 junta soldiers stationed at the fire station in Chaung U Township were attacked while they came out to clear mines for copper trucks off the road.

BRAVE HEART ARMY-BHA comrades ambushed these 3 junta soldiers, killing 2 and 1 escaping. During the battle, 2 MA11 and 3 magazines, 1 hand grenade, 40 rounds of 5.56 ammunition, and 2 helmets were seized.

BHA expressed thanks to MONYWA SPECIAL Date Date Kyae and Youth Revolution Attack Force for helping and renting guns due to the smaller number of weapons of its force in carrying out the mission.

Midland Dolphins Column – MLDC announced that 17 junta soldiers were killed in an attack on the Lin Zin police station and the military council troops that came to reinforce them in Salin Township, Magway Division.

It is said that the revolutionary forces started attacking Lin Zin Police Station in Salin Township at about 5:00 a.m. on May 18 with RPGs and small arms. The exchange of fire lasted about 2 hours. In this battle, 11 junta soldiers were killed. Though revolutionary forces were able to seize 3 bunkers inside the police station, they had to retreat due to insufficient ammunition and the arrival of reinforcements from the junta. The junta reinforcements coming to reinforce the Lin Zin police station were also intercepted, killing 6 more junta soldiers.

The attack was carried out cooperatively by the Midland Dolphins Column-MLDC, SLN-LPDF, Generation-Z Army, Daung Sit Aung, Thunder Guerrilla Force, Salin PaKaFa, and Minbu District Battalions 1, 4, and 5, and 2 people’s defense comrades were reportedly injured.

It is reported that a 4 million kyat fund is needed to buy 4 months of rice for the comrades of Pakokku District Battalion 11. On May 22, Pakokku District Battalion 11 appealed to the public.

“We only eat 2 meals a day. If we don’t have bullets, we can still attack with mines. If we don’t have rice, it’s not easy for our comrades to continue working because we don’t have the strength. We still need about 4 million kyat to buy rice for 4 months in the rainy season,” it stated. It is said that the region is war-torn, so it is in a situation with no public support.
